The Gloppefoss (also Gloppefossen ) is a waterfall in the Norwegian municipality of Valle in the province of Agder . It lies at the end of a side valley (Veiådalen) of the Setesdal . The river Veiåni falls 230 m over a cliff into the valley. This makes it one of the highest waterfalls in Setesdal.
